WebThe most successful and universally recognized deck of cards is that based on a complement of 52, divided into four suits, each containing 13 ranks, so that each card is uniquely identifiable by suit and rank. Suits The suitmarks of the international, or standard, deck indicate two black and two red suits—namely spades, clubs, hearts, and diamonds. WebApr 13, 2024 · Poker is played with a standard, 52-card deck. A standard playing card deck, also called a poker deck, contains 52 distinct cards.. These cards are divided into four suits: . Hearts and Diamonds are the two red suits. These are sometimes abbreviated as H and D.Clubs and Spades are the two black suits. WebHow Many Black Suit Cards Are There? There are 26 black cards in a deck of cards or just over 50 percent. A standard deck of playing cards has 52 cards divided into four suits: clubs, diamonds, spades, and hearts. Each suit contains 13 cards: Ace, two, three, four, five, six, seven, eight, nine, ten, jack (J), queen (Q), and king (K). ... WebThere are four suits— spades, hearts, diamonds, and clubs—with 13 cards in each suit. Spades and clubs are black; hearts and diamonds are red. If one of these cards is …
